Quick Summary

Brazil are favorites to beat Norway in the World Cup Round of 16. Vinicius and Endrick spearhead their attack against a Norway side led by Haaland, with over 2.5 goals likely.

Brazil look primed to brush aside Norway in this Round of 16 meeting. They've collected three wins from four World Cup outings this summer, including a 3-0 thrashing of Scotland and another clean sheet against Haiti. Norway mixed results, beating Ivory Coast and Senegal yet collapsing 1-4 to France.

Paqueta misses out through injury while Raphinha stays doubtful. That forces adjustments in midfield but the attack stays loaded with Vinicius Junior leading the line alongside Endrick and Cunha. Norway arrive without any reported absences, fielding Haaland up top with Odegaard pulling strings behind him.

The sides haven't met in any competitive fixture for nearly two decades. Brazil's five titles and consistent recent scoring give them the edge at MetLife Stadium on July 5 2026. Expect them to control possession and create chances through Vini Junior's pace and Endrick's runs in behind.

Norway rely heavily on Haaland's finishing. He's already netted five times in the tournament and remains a genuine threat on the break. Their 4-3-3 shape mirrors Brazil's, which could open spaces if both teams push forward early.

Alisson starts in goal for Brazil with Marquinhos and Gabriel anchoring the back line. Casemiro and Bruno Guimaraes provide steel in the middle. For Norway, Nyland keeps goal while Ajer and Heggem handle central defense. The game kicks off at 4 p.m. ET and promises attacking intent from both sides.

Brazil should edge the contest through superior depth and tournament experience. Norway have shown they can score but their defense looks vulnerable against top opposition.
